3,5-dibromo-2,6-difluoro-pyridine

Description:
3,5-Dibromo-2,6-difluoropyridine is a heterocyclic organic compound characterized by a pyridine ring substituted with two bromine atoms and two fluorine atoms. The presence of these halogen substituents significantly influences its chemical properties, including reactivity and polarity. The bromine atoms, being larger and more polarizable, can enhance the compound's ability to participate in electrophilic aromatic substitution reactions, while the fluorine atoms, being highly electronegative, can affect the electron density on the ring, making it more susceptible to nucleophilic attack. This compound is typically used in various applications, including pharmaceuticals and agrochemicals, due to its potential biological activity. It is important to handle this substance with care, as halogenated compounds can exhibit toxicity and environmental persistence. Additionally, its physical properties, such as boiling point and solubility, are influenced by the presence of the halogens, which can affect its behavior in different solvents and conditions. Overall, 3,5-dibromo-2,6-difluoropyridine is a versatile compound with significant implications in chemical synthesis and research.
Formula:C5HBr2F2N
InChI:InChI=1/C5HBr2F2N/c6-2-1-3(7)5(9)10-4(2)8/h1H
SMILES:c1c(c(F)nc(c1Br)F)Br
Synonyms:
  • 3,5-Dibromo-2,6-Difluoropyridine
  • Pyridine, 3,5-Dibromo-2,6-Difluoro-
